Local Resources
Bath Area Food Bank, 807 Middle St in Bath will continue to help Georgetown folks. If you know anyone in need, please call the food bank any day, 207-737-9289, and they will provide free food. If you have nonperishables to donate, you can put them in the box at the back of the church. First Baptist Church in Bath also has food and clothing available.
Age Friendly Group in Georgetown. This is a group who helps with miscellaneous needs in Georgetown. FMI go to agefriendlygeorgetown.org or check The Georgetown Tide newspaper. They are a resource for food for families in town, including Thanksgiving baskets.
The Georgetown Community Center is a food resource for families in town. See Joyce Oliver if you have any questions about these Georgetown programs.
